About This Trial
The purpose of this research is to evaluate if hypnotherapy delivered digitally will help your GI symptoms.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ion criteria:
* Patients will meet criteria for at least one upper GI DGBI including functional dyspepsia, any nausea/vomiting disorder, or functional abdominal bloating. Lower GI DGBIs, such as IBS, are allowable if the primary symptom is either an upper GI symptom or bloating/distension.
